    PERLINDUNGAN HUKUM TERHADAP PIHAK YANG BERITIKAD BAIK DALAM PERJANJIAN JUAL BELI

    Full text link
    ABSTRAK Wibowo, Priyo Adi. Perlindungan Hukum Terhadap Pihak Yang Beritikad Baik Dalam Perjanjian Jual Beli. Skripsi. Tegal: Program Studi Ilmu Hukum Fakultas Hukum, Universitas Pancasakti Tegal. 2019. Itikad baik merupakan faktor yang paling penting dalam hukum karena tingkah dari anggota masyarakat itu tidak selamanya diatur dalam peraturan perundang-undangan, tetapi ada juga dalam peraturan yang berdasarkan persetujuan masing-masing pihak dan oleh karena peraturan-peraturan tersebut hanya dibuat oleh manusia biasa maka peraturan-peraturan itu tidak ada yang sempurna. Penelitian ini bertujuan untuk mengetahui: 1) perlindungan hukum terhadap pihak yang beritikad baik dalam perjanjian jual beli pada putusan Nomor 7/Pdt.G/2019/PN.Tgl, 2) akibat hukum perjanjian jual beli yang obyek hukumnya telah diletakkan sita eksekusi pada putusan Nomor 7/Pdt.G/2019/PN.Tgl. Jenis penelitian yang digunakan adalah penelitian kepustakaan dengan pendekatan penelitian hukum yuridis normatif. Sumber data utama yang digunakan dalam penelitian ini adalah data sekunder dengan metode pengumpulan data studi kepustakaan dan dokumen. Metode analisis data dengan deskriptif kualitatif. Hasil penelitian dapat disimpulkan bahwa: 1) Perlindungan hukum terhadap pihak yang beritikad baik dalam perjanjian jual beli pada putusan Nomor 7/Pdt.G/ 2019/PN.Tgl yaitu ketentuan Pasal 1338 KUH Perdata. Jadi Akte Pengikatan Jual Beli atas Objek Perkara I dan Objek Perkara II secara hukum sah dan mempunyai kekuatan hukum mengikat terhadap Penggugat dan Tergugat II dan Tergugat III; 2) Akibat hukum perjanjian jual beli yang obyek hukumnya telah diletakkan sita eksekusi pada putusan Nomor 7/Pdt.G/2019/PN.Tgl mengingat Penetapan Ketua Pengadilan Negeri Tegal Nomor 1/Pen.Pdt.Eks/2013/PN.Tgl dan Berita Acara sita Eksekusi Nomor 1/Ba.Pdt.Eks./2013/PN.Tgl telah diterbitkan tidak sejalan dengan isi dan maksud dari Surat Edaran Mahkamah Agung No. 5 Tahun 1975 tanggal 1 Desember 1975, maka Sita Eksekusi yang telah diletakkan atas Objek Perkara I dan Objek Perkara II adalah cacat juridis dan tidak mempunyai kekuatan hukum mengikat dan harus segera diangkat. Sedangkan Akta Nomor: 01 yaitu Pengikatan Jual Beli tanggal 5 September 2017 dan Akta Nomor: 03 yaitu Pengikatan Jual Beli tanggal 5 September 2017 telah dinyatakan merupakan produk bukti yang sah yang dibuat oleh Notaris sesuai dengan kewenangannya. Maka Penggugat secara hukum merupakan pembeli yang beritikad baik dan dinyatakan sebagai pemilik sah atas tanah objek sengketa I dan objek sengketa II. Berdasarkan hasil penelitian ini diharapkan akan menjadi bahan informasi dan masukan bagi mahasiswa, akademisi, praktisi, dan semua pihak yang membutuhkan di lingkungan Fakultas Hukum Universitas Pancasakti Tegal. Kata Kunci: Perlindungan Hukum, Itikad Baik, dan Jual Beli. ===================================================================================================== ABSTRACT Wibowo, Priyo Adi. Legal Protection of Parties in Good faith in the Sale and Purchase Agreement. Skripsi. Tegal: Law Faculty Faculty of Law Study Program, Tegal Pancasakti University. 2019. Good faith is the most important factor in law because the behavior of members of the community is not always regulated in legislation, but there are also rules based on the agreement of each party and because these regulations are only made by ordinary people, the regulations -the rules are not perfect. This study aims to determine: 1) legal protection of parties in good faith in the sale and purchase agreement in the decision Number 7 / Pdt.G/2019/PN.Tgl, 2) due to the law of the sale and purchase agreement where the legal object has been confiscated execution in the decision Number 7/Pdt.G/2019/PN.Tgl. The type of research used is library research with normative juridical legal research approaches. The main data source used in this research is secondary data with the method of collecting literature and document study data. Methods of data analysis with qualitative descriptive. The results of the study can be concluded that: 1) Legal protection of parties in good faith in the sale and purchase agreement in the decision Number 7/Pdt.G/2019/PN.Tgl namely the provisions of Article 1338 of the Civil Code. So the Purchase Binding Agreement on Case Object I and Case Object II is legally valid and has binding legal force against Plaintiffs and Defendants II and Defendants III; 2) The legal consequences of the sale and purchase agreement which the legal object has been placed confiscated in the execution of decision Number 7/Pdt.G/2019/PN.Tgl considering the Determination of the Chairman of the Tegal District Court Number 1/Pen.Pdt.Eks/2013/PN.Tgl and Minutes Confiscation of Execution Number 1/Ba.Pdt.Eks./2013/PN.Tgl has been issued is not in line with the content and purpose of the Supreme Court Circular No. 5 of 1975 dated 1 December 1975, the Sita Execution that had been placed on Case Object I and Object Case II was a juridical defect and had no binding legal force and had to be immediately appointed. Whereas Deed Number: 01, the Binding of Sale and Purchasing on September 5, 2017 and Deed Number: 03, Binding of Sale and Purchasing, September 5, 2017, has been declared as a valid proof product made by a Notary in accordance with its authority. Then the Plaintiff is legally a buyer in good faith and declared as the legal owner of the disputed object I and disputed object II. Based on the results of this study are expected to be material information and input for students, academics, practitioners, and all those who need it in the Faculty of Law, University of Pancasakti Tegal.     Going Beyond Counting First Authors in Author Co-citation Analysis

    Full text link
    The present study examines one of the fundamental aspects of author co-citation analysis (ACA) - the way co-citation counts are defined. Co-citation counting provides the data on which all subsequent statistical analyses and mappings are based, and we compare ACA results based on two different types of co-citation counting - the traditional type that only counts the first one among a cited work's authors on the one hand and a non-traditional type that takes into account the first 5 authors of a cited work on the other hand. Results indicate that the picture produced through this non-traditional author co-citation counting contains more coherent author groups and is therefore considerably clearer. However, this picture represents fewer specialties in the research field being studied than that produced through the traditional first-author co-citation counting when the same number of top-ranked authors is selected and analyzed. Reasons for these effects are discussed

    Variations on the Author

    Full text link
    “Variations on the Author” discusses two of Eduardo Coutinho’s recent films (Um Dia na Vida, from 2010, and Últimas Conversas, posthumously released in 2015) and their contribution to the general question of documentary authorship. The director’s filmography is characterized by a consistent yet self-effacing form of authorial self-inscription: Coutinho often features as an interviewer that rather than express opinions propels discourses; an interviewer that is good at listening. This mode of self-inscription characterizes him as an author who is not expressive but who is nonetheless markedly present on the screen. In Um Dia na Vida, however, Coutinho is completely absent form the image, while Últimas Conversas, on the contrary, includes a confessional prologue that moves the director from the margins to the center of his films. This article examines the ways in which these works stand out in the filmography of a director who offers new insights into the notion of cinematic authorship

    Appropriate Similarity Measures for Author Cocitation Analysis

    Full text link
    We provide a number of new insights into the methodological discussion about author cocitation analysis. We first argue that the use of the Pearson correlation for measuring the similarity between authors’ cocitation profiles is not very satisfactory. We then discuss what kind of similarity measures may be used as an alternative to the Pearson correlation. We consider three similarity measures in particular. One is the well-known cosine. The other two similarity measures have not been used before in the bibliometric literature.     Dispelling the Myths Behind First-author Citation Counts

    Full text link
    We conducted a full-scale evaluative citation analysis study of scholars in the XML research field to explore just how different from each other author rankings resulting from different citation counting methods actually are, and to demonstrate the capability of emerging data and tools on the Web in supporting more realistic citation counting methods. Our results contest some common arguments for the continued use of first-author citation counts in the evaluation of scholars, such as high correlations between author rankings by first-author citation counts and other citation counting methods, and high costs of using more realistic citation counting methods that are not well-supported by the ISI databases. It is argued that increasingly available digital full text research papers make it possible for citation analysis studies to go beyond what the ISI databases have directly supported and to employ more sophisticated methods

    We have done our best to complete the author checklist relating to the use of animals in the hut study. Note that the objective for the hut study was to evaluate the IRS treatment applications for residual efficacy against Anopheles mosquitoes, including the local An. coluzzii mosquito population. Cows were only used to attract mosquitoes into the huts and no tests were carried out directly on the cows. The author checklist is intended for use with studies where experiments are carried out on animals, which is why we have had such difficulty in completing this for the hut study, as many of the questions do not relate to how the cows were used

    Author Under Sail The Imagination of Jack London, 1893-1902

    No full text
    In Author Under Sail, Jay Williams offers the first complete literary biography of Jack London as a professional writer engaged in the labor of writing. It examines the authorial imagination in London's work, the use of imagination in both his fiction and nonfiction, and the ways he defined imagination in the creative process in his business dealings with his publishers, editors, and agents. In this first volume of a two-volume biography, Williams traverses the years 1893 to 1902, from London's "Story of a Typhoon" to The People of the Abyss. The Jack London who emerges in the pages of Author Under Sail is a writer whose partnership with publishers, most notably his productive alliance with George Brett of Macmillan, was one of the most formative in American literary history. London pioneered many author models during the heyday of realism and naturalism, blurring the boundaries of these popular genres by focusing on absorption and theatricality and the representation of the seen and unseen. London created an impassioned, sincere, and extremely personal realism unlike that of other American writers of the time.
